What's the Deal with "Apples to Apples"?

Let's unpack it. The idiom "apples to apples" is all about making a fair comparison. You wouldn't compare an apple to an orange if you were trying to decide which fruit makes the best pie (though, honestly, both are great!). You'd compare different types of apples, or different types of oranges. It's about looking at similar things to get a real sense of their differences and similarities.
